Ficus pumila, also known as the climbing or creeping fig, is a dwarf species of ficus. There are three main variations of Ficus pumila. The standard Green coloration, a variegated form, and the miniature Oak leaf form ‘Quercifolia’. All three variations will grow quickly along the substrate and climb walls and decorations when being used in an enclosure. Ficus pumila is very adaptable to different growing environments and conditions. An overall great plant to work with!

Ficus pumila can tolerate temperatures just above freezing but should be kept between 55-85 degrees. Low to moderate lighting.
